Partner files from Quillbrook arrive via the nightly SFTP drop and are ingested by the `drop-sweeper` job after checksum validation. Reviewers should verify that any change to the parser keeps the quarantine path intact for malformed rows. Ingestion state and file manifests live in the intake database, reachable via the connection string below.

primary connection of yagep-kahip = redis://giliel_svc:zYiKsLL2PLpfPL@db-348f.xolmarsys.corp:5432/fenwyn

Team,

Quick one ahead of our incoming director Priya joining Monday. We've trimmed the Haleport marketing budget by roughly a quarter for the year — mostly paused sponsorships and the Windrose rebrand, which is now on ice. Day-to-day campaigns for Cindercart continue, just leaner. Priya, nothing here should spook you; the fundamentals are solid, we're just tightening while we reposition. Happy to walk through numbers whenever suits. The strategic context sits in the confidential note below.

— Marcus

management briefing: Project Ulavan slips by two quarters because of the staffing delay.

Ticket: missed pick-up, batch of twelve calibration weights bound for the Ferrowick metrology lab. The Calder Couriers driver arrived after the dock closed and the batch remained in the secure cage overnight. Re-booked for tomorrow, 09:00 slot. The weights must not be re-boxed. At hand-over, apply the instruction below.

handover note for kagep-kagup: the holok holdor courier leaves the rusix sorox fenwyn ledger at gate 3590 under passcode 092644

Subject: SQL lint cut-over done

Hi — quick summary. The Quarrelstone repo moved from the old ad-hoc SQL checks to the Fintlock linter as of last night. All legacy suppression comments were stripped; CI now blocks on any rule violation, no warnings tier. Pre-commit hooks were updated, so pull before you commit anything. Keyword casing and join-style rules are the big changes you'll notice. The active linter configuration is below.

config for kawif-hahig:
zorix:
  log_level: error
  metrics_host: metrics.zorix.lumiclabs.internal
  pool_size: 16